
Product Description
A collection of futuristic tales from Hugo and Nebula Award-winning authors includes "Pillar of Fire" by Ray Bradbury, "Tomorrow and Tomorrow and Tomorrow" by Kurt Vonnegut, and "Repent Harlequin!" by Harlan Ellison. Read by Richard Dreyfus, Robin Williams, et al.
From AudioFile
In this science fiction short story anthology, diverse players tackle a variety of excellent, good, and mediocre stories, with the positives much outweighing the negatives. There are some truly classic tales here: "By His Bootstraps," by Robert A. Heinlein; "'Repent, Harlequin!' Said the Ticktockman," by Harlan Ellison; "R.U.R.," by Karel Capek--to name just three. Among the offerings are stories by authors Kurt Vonnegut, Fredric Brown, A.E. van Vogt, Octavia E. Butler, C.L. Moore, and Connie Willis. The readers are mostly well known and of vast talent: Richard Dreyfuss, Charles Durning, Tom Poston, Lynne Thigpen, Rene Auberjonois, Barbara Rush, Robin Williams, among others. Truly well done.
